Leading Yourself Through Discomfort: Stay Present, Stop Avoiding

from The Tessa Tubbs Podcast · host Tessa Tubbs

In this solo episode of The Tessa Tubbs Podcast, Tessa shares practical, real-life strategies for leading yourself through discomfort without numbing out, spiraling, or escaping into overwork, overeating, shopping, scrolling, or people-pleasing.You’ll learn how to tell the difference between:Moments where you need to stay present and work the plan, andMoments where you genuinely need to soothe your system and regroupTessa walks through her personal “go-to” tools, including:Changing your scenery to reset your nervous systemWarmth and touch cues (a warm mug, a soft blanket) to calm the body and stay groundedJournaling to get thoughts out of your head and back into reality (and rewrite the narrative)Talking it out with a trusted person, and how AI can support reflection in the momentPrayer as an anchor for those who are people of faithIf you’ve been trying to “push through” discomfort by outrunning it, this episode will help you build self-leadership that’s honest, grounded, and sustainable.🎧 Listen now and practice staying present, telling the truth, and choosing what you need on purpose.
